Founder’s Note - From the Founder

The Ginunting is unapologetically forward-driven, and its defining feature is the forward curve of the blade. From the tip through the edge line, the geometry continually captures and draws the cut toward the direction of the crossguard. This design maintains cutting engagement throughout the entire slashing motion rather than concentrating force at a single point.

That same forward-biased geometry allows the blade to dig in with authority while still returning rapidly after each slash. The blade does not stall or overcommit—it completes the action and resets naturally, preserving readiness and control.

This balance of continuous edge engagement, decisive forward pressure, and fast recovery is what defines the Ginunting. It is not a blade built for refinement or ornamentation, but for consistent, repeatable performance under demanding conditions.

Technical Breakdown - Design & Performance Characteristics

Forward Blade Curve

  • The continuous forward curve captures from the tip and draws the edge toward the crossguard, maintaining cutting engagement throughout the entire slashing path.

Weight Distribution

  • Forward-biased mass enhances slashing authority while supporting efficient recovery for rapid follow-up movement.

Blade Geometry

  • Broad, purposeful profile optimized for structural strength, edge stability, and predictable tracking.

Center of Balance

  • Tuned forward to reinforce blade presence without compromising return speed or control.

Protective Finish

  • Midnight Black Cerakote provides abrasion resistance, corrosion protection, and a low-visibility tactical appearance.

Functional Role

  • Designed for practitioners who prioritize durability, authority, and continuous readiness.
